This week, The Plotaholics are covering a tale that’s probably older than a percentage of our listeners as we delve into the 1989 Christmas classic National Lampoon’s Christmas Vacation, starring Chevy Chase (pre-Donald Glover feud), Beverly D’Angelo, Johnny Galecki, Juliette Lewis, and Randy Quaid.
In this film, the last family man on Earth, Clark Griswold (Chase), wants to give his family a good old fashioned American Christmas. Unfortunately for him, squirrels, a lack of saws, tree sap, a dog, his neighbors, his in-laws, Jelly of the Month Club memberships, and his own ineptitudes get in his way.
